repaglinide: prescribing and clinical use

repaglinide: clinical details
Prescribing considerations
- Licensed for adults; safety and efficacy below age 18 are not established, and clinical study evidence above age 75 is lacking.
- Assess hypoglycaemia risk, meal pattern, nutrition, renal and hepatic status, and interacting medicines.
- Acute illness, infection, trauma or surgery can destabilise glycaemic control and may require temporary treatment review.
- Combining repaglinide with metformin increases hypoglycaemia risk.
- The SmPC notes a possible association with increased acute coronary syndrome incidence.
Contraindications and cautions
- Hypersensitivity to repaglinide or an excipient
- Type 1 diabetes
- Diabetic ketoacidosis, with or without coma
- Severe hepatic impairment
- Concurrent gemfibrozil
Monitoring
- Periodic blood glucose and glycated haemoglobin to assess response and detect primary or secondary failure
- Frequency and severity of hypoglycaemia
- Close glucose and clinical monitoring when relevant interacting treatments are started or stopped
Clinical pharmacology
Repaglinide is rapidly absorbed and highly protein bound. It is metabolised mainly by CYP2C8, with a smaller CYP3A4 contribution, and is also an OATP1B1 substrate. It has a short plasma half-life and its metabolites are cleared mainly through bile.

repaglinide interactions
Repaglinide has clinically important metabolic and blood-glucose interactions. Check prescribed, non-prescription and herbal products before use.
Gemfibrozil
Markedly increases repaglinide exposure and can cause prolonged hypoglycaemia; concurrent use is contraindicated.
Clopidogrel
Increases repaglinide exposure and may increase hypoglycaemia risk, requiring clinical review and glucose monitoring.
Trimethoprim, ciclosporin or deferasirox
May increase repaglinide exposure; combinations should generally be avoided or monitored closely when necessary.
